As the Skills Contracts Operations Manager, you will be responsible for the end-to-end operational management of adult skills contracts across the UK. This includes Skills Bootcamps, Adult Skills Fund (ASF), Free Courses for Jobs (FCFJ), and subcontracted provision. Your primary objective is to ensure the successful execution of all contracts in line with commissioner specifications, funding rules, financial profiles, and quality expectations. You will drive performance across a contract portfolio valued at approximately £10m, ensuring delivery aligns with allocation profiles, funding regulations, and agreed KPIs. You will play a pivotal role in maximising contract performance, optimising resource allocation, mitigating risks, and ensuring high levels of learner outcomes and commissioner satisfaction.

Key Responsibilities

  • Contract & Performance Management
    • Lead end-to-end contract management across all adult skills provision (Bootcamps, ASF, FCFJ and subcontracted delivery).
    • Translate contract allocations and profiles into operational delivery plans that maximise funding utilisation across programmes.
    • Monitor performance against financial, quality, and KPI targets, implementing corrective actions where required.
    • Conduct regular contract performance reviews and ensure delivery remains aligned with commissioner expectations.
    • Identify risks to delivery, develop mitigation strategies, and implement step-in measures where necessary.
  • Delivery & Operational Planning
    • Work closely with Business Development, Enrolment, Delivery, Quality, Data & Claims teams to ensure joined-up operational execution.
    • Analyse ILR data and FIS reports to interpret funding performance, learner progress, and profile achievement.
    • Use performance data to plan cohort starts, tutor allocation, and delivery volumes to match contract values and financial profiles.
    • Ensure delivery planning aligns with a £10m contract portfolio and supports full allocation utilisation.
  • Quality & Compliance
    • Work in partnership with the Head of Quality and Curriculum, Heads of Curriculum, and Curriculum Innovations Manager to drive QAR performance across all provision.
    • Implement contractual performance and quality improvement plans where required.
    • Ensure full compliance with DfE funding rules and contract-specific requirements.
    • Maintain oversight of audit readiness, funding compliance, and data integrity.
  • Stakeholder Engagement
    • Act as the operational lead for commissioner relationships relating to contract performance.
    • Collaborate with internal stakeholders to ensure alignment between curriculum planning, enrolment activity, and contract outcomes.
    • Support in understanding operational capacity and performance trends for future bids.

Qualifications & Experience

Essential

  • Proven experience managing adult education or skills contracts.
  • Experience working within performance and/or contract management frameworks.
  • Strong understanding of DfE funding rules and contract compliance requirements.
  • Experience of business planning, budget preparation, and financial monitoring.
  • Experience working with adult learners and adult skills provision.
  • Ability to manage and drive performance improvement across multiple programmes.
  • Strong working knowledge of ILR reporting and the ability to interpret FIS reports to inform delivery planning.

Desirable

  • Experience engaging with internal and external quality assurance mechanisms.
  • Experience managing subcontracted provision.
  • Advanced data analysis capability within ILR systems.

This role is primarily based at our Derby branch. However, we are open to the role being based in Sheffield, with hybrid working arrangements considered where operationally appropriate.
